Arbitrary Writing Challenge: No Send Letters

This letter is not meant to send. The simple act of writing this letter is therapeutic for you. Get it all out, the pain. The frustration. Let them know your deepest feelings.

You have always wanted to tell them. Write a letter to someone who hurt you. Don't hold back, let it flow out of you. Express your pain and the trauma and loss you have had to endure. Release it all, it's unhealthy to keep it all in. Release your anger on the page, let it all go. This really works!

Or, write a letter to someone you have wronged. Explain how sorry you feel, and ask for forgiveness. Take responsibility for your actions and reconcile the past. Allow your heart to be vulnerable and express itself. You do not have to take full responsibility as it takes two in every situation, but accepting fault and apologizing goes a long way.

Perhaps you need to write a letter to your unrequited crush. That guy or girl who captured your attention and heart, but the timing was off. Nevertheless, they stroll across your thoughts more times than you will admit ;) Write what you envisioned in your mind- how you wish it would have gone.

This week's writing challenge is to write a heartfelt letter to someone. Whether you are forgiving, asking forgiveness, healing, or expressing, tell this person everything you couldn't tell them to their face. Be explicit and direct. Reveal your innermost emotions and convey what you wish them to realize. Letting it all out in your letter will help you release the weight so you can move forward and get to living <3

The more you let out the more empowered and in control of your self you will feel. Put pride aside and muzzle Ego- this letter is for you. This is to help and heal you so you can move on.
